• 首页

  • 题库

  • 网课

  • 在线模考

  • 搜标题
  • 搜题干
  • 搜选项
题目列表

算法设计与分析章节练习(2019.12.04)

  • 多项选择题

    穷举法求解问题的两个基本要素()

    A.确定穷举对象和穷举范围
    B.确定判定条件
    C.确定穷举所需要的时间
    D.确定列举穷举的地点

  • 问答题

    设计分治算法求一个数组中的最大元素,并分析时间性能

    答案:

  • 单项选择题

    以下代码求和结果应该是:()

    A.以上三项都不对
    B.2550
    C.2500
    D.5050

  • 问答题

    对于给定的无向图G=(V,E),设计具有判断图是否存在环功能的深度优先算法。

    答案:

  • 问答题

    如果修改归并排序算法,将数组分成1/3和2/3大小不等的两部分,分别排序后再归并,算法的最坏时间复杂度有什么变化?

    答案:

    设对n个元素排序的时间为T(n),对两部分排序的时间分别为T(n/3)和,合并的时间为n-1,得到递归方程:

  • 单项选择题

    整数5和10的最大公约数是()。

    A.10
    B.5
    C.30
    D.50

  • 问答题

    给出一个C=(A-B)∪(B-A)的算法。

    答案:

  • 判断题

    直接插入排序是不稳定排序。

    答案:错误
  • 问答题

    设计递归算法生成n个元素的所有排列对象。

    答案:

  • 问答题

    试用贪心算法求解下列问题:将正整数n分解为若干个互不相同的自然数之和,使这些自然数的乘积最大。

    答案:

版权所有©考试资料网(ppkao.com) 长沙求知信息技术有限公司 All Rights Reserved

湘公网安备 43010202000353号备案号: 湘ICP备14005140号-2

经营许可证号 : 湘B2-20140064